I don’t think we’ve given Frondell quite enough love for his season in the SHL – he’s been a dominant goalscorer despite this being a very tough league and him not even turning 19 until the first week of May!
Anton is now up to 18G, 25P in 41GP while he’s been bounced all around the lineup the whole season. His goal total is the highest by an 18-year-old in the SHL since Daniel Sedin put up 21 in 1999 (50GP) and is the 4th highest total of all time. His point total is less historically impressive but I think it’s noteworthy that he’s now tied Leo Carlsson’s point total from 2023 when he was the same age (44GP).
As we may need to temper expectations and hype around Kantserov’s KHL records for his age due to that league having deteriorated in quality lately, mostly due to talent fleeing after the onset of the Ukraine war in early 2022, I think the opposite may be true for Frondell’s current performance. Tons of talent has been jumping over to the SHL lately and it’s arguably the 3rd best league in the world now – what the kid has done in the context of this current league is pretty nutty lol
